The Genesis of Linux Linuxs origin story is a testament to the power of open-source collaboration. Conceived by Linus Torvalds in 1991 as a personal project to enhance his understanding of Unix-like operating systems, Linux quickly garnered a community of developers passionate about creating a free, robust, and versatile alternative to proprietary OSes. Unlike Windows or macOS, Linuxs codebase is freely accessible, allowing anyone to inspect, modify, and distribute it under the GNU General PublicLicense (GPL). This open-source philosophy has fostered an environment of innovation and rapid iteration, where features and improvements are driven by the collective intelligence of developers worldwide. Over the decades, Linux has matured into a highly customizable, secure, and efficient OS, capable of running on a wide array of hardware configurations—from desktops and servers to smartphones and embedded systems. The Crossover Phenomenon Linux crossover refers to the trend of users and enterprises migrating from proprietary OSes like Windows and macOS to Linux-based systems. This transition is not limited to tech enthusiasts or developers; it spans across various industries, including education, finance, healthcare, and government. The reasons for this crossover are multifaceted and compelling. 1. Cost Efficiency One of the most immediate benefits of adopting Linux is cost savings. Unlike Windows or macOS, which require licensing fees, Linux is free to use, deploy, and distribute. For businesses, this translates into significant cost reductions, particularly in environments where multiple workstations or servers are deployed. Educational institutions can also allocate funds saved on software licenses towards other critical areas, such as improving infrastructure or expanding educational resources. 2. Enhanced Security Security is paramount in todays digital world, where cyber threats are becoming increasingly sophisticated. Linuxs robust security architecture, including its Unix-like permissions model, regular security updates, and diverse user base that continually identifies and patches vulnerabilities, makes it a more secure OS compared to its proprietary counterparts.
